Brian McOmber (It Comes at Night, Krisha, Ugly) is scoring the upcoming indie drama Mickey and the Bear. The film marks the feature directorial debut of Annabelle Attanasio and stars Camila Morrone, James Badge Dale, Calvin Demba, Ben Rosenfield and Rebecca Henderson. The movie follows a teenage girl who has to keep her single, veteran father afloat, navigating his mercurial moods, opioid addiction, and grief over the loss of his wife. Attanasio also wrote the screenplay. Lizzie Shapiro, Mackenzie Berkman, Taylor Shung, Anja Murmann and Sabine Schenk are producing the project. Mickey and the Bear will premiere in March at the 2019 SXSW Film Festival.

McOmber’s other recent projects also include Little Woods starring Tessa Thompson, Lily James & James Badge Dale. The movie premiered at last year’s Tribeca Film Festival and will be released on April 19 by Neon. The composer has also composed the music for the documentary Hail Satan? directed by Penny Lane about the rise of The Satanic Temple. The movie just premiered at the Sundance Film Festival this week.
